by Jillsy609
It would tell me I was 20 miles away from the park when I was standing at the visitor center. It would only guide me to something when I was driving toward it. There is no search option to search a popular place in the park to figure out how close you are to it or how to get to it. You have to be driving toward it before it will ever come up and even then popular pull outs or scenes don’t show up all of the time. If you want an app that will tell you where the vault toilets are or where about 1/10 of the picnic tables are, then this app is okay. If you are wanting an app to guide you to a particular place in the park or an app that can be reliable to know where you are in the park this is not the app.
by JohnPoltrock
We gave it a try on our trip to Acadia. It really has a lot of potential, but there still a lot of glitches and details to work out. Specifically, we could not get the audio to work because it said that it was not downloaded, which it was. There’s no way to force download it like with most apps. We went to the hotel that night and tried it on Wi-Fi. Thinking that may be the issue, made no difference in the audio never worked again. the part where you can navigate to see where you’re at on the map is very helpful except it always wants to orient at this weird angle instead of straight down and when you move it it moves right back. Makes it really difficult to know where you’re at and what’s ahead of you when it’s at that slanted angle I think with some changes to include the ability to specifically download and confirm that it’s download and a few other things it would be great.
by Luvbruce
We just visited Utah and used this app in the parks. It’s very good. The tour guide feature and map are great. The map is very helpful. There were times google did not know where we were but this app did. The only reason I didn’t give this 5 stars is we wished there was more talking while we were driving through the parks. Even for example pointing out a mountain range in the distance. Also, keep your phone charging when using it. The battery definitely goes down quicker. Overall a great app.
